Cooperation of CE4Reg research team with Małopolska Marshal Office: Presentation of relation from international workshop on public private partnership in circular economy (CE) and industrial symbiosis (IS) at SYMBI project at regional stakeholders meeting.
SYMBI project Industrial Symbiosis and Recourse Efficient Circular Economy financed by Interreg programme of the EU (https://www.interregeurope.eu/SYMBI/). The other participants of the project represent cities and regions from Spain, Slovenia, Finland, Italy, Hungary and Greece. Principal investigator of the project dr Anna Avdiushchenko was invited at the international workshop on PPP for CE and IS as an expert from Malopolska region. The workshop was held at Kozani municipality (Greece). There were discussed issues related to pros and cons of PPP project, its opportunities and limitation.
On 15th of September, Malopolska Marshal Office organised regional stakeholder meeting, where dr Anna Avdiushchenko presented main results of workshop from Kozani, including experience of partners from Greece, Finland, Poland and Slovenia in PPP and opportunities for project focused on circular economy and industrial symbiosis.
Prof. Joanna Kulczycka, research partner of the CE4reg project, presented best practices of industrial symbiosis form Poland.
